Output 24eec40a9551e1224bcf14e88480daac48ffc27d46a4b7fb919e07a1e8cf03c8:12

value
42645950
script pubkey
OP_0 OP_PUSHBYTES_32 1f3cb351f8176f7596d69d0e48f22bc0be45a1b6560cc9fe55236b8b3958afee
address
bc1qru7tx50czahht9kkn58y3u3tczlytgdk2cxvnlj4yd4ckw2c4lhq6g8a89
transaction
24eec40a9551e1224bcf14e88480daac48ffc27d46a4b7fb919e07a1e8cf03c8
confirmations
309565
spent
true